Kathmandu (KTM) to Turukhansk (THX) Flight Distance

The flight distance from Tribhuvan International Airport (KTM) in Kathmandu, Nepal to Turukhansk Airport (THX) in Turukhansk, Russia is 4,240 kilometers (2,635 miles / 2,290 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 6h, flying north at a heading of 2°.
